Job Description


Threat Analyst

12 Month Contract + Extensions

100% remote


Insight Global is looking for an Insider Threat Analyst for one of our top customers. This is a 12 month contract and is a remote opportunity. A successful candidate will have experience with threat detection and insider risk management, experience working in a SOC or with an incident response team and experience working with threat detection tools and techniques! Experience with Microsoft Purview is an asset


Required Skills & Experience

- 3+ years experience in a cybersecurity role, within insider threat analysis or security operations.

- Working knowledge of cybersecurity concepts (network security, endpoint security, and data protection)

- Proficient in security monitoring tools (SIEM, EDR, DLP, UEBA)

- Experience conducting security investigations, using forensic analysis techniques (someone who can understand these techniques and be able to tell a story)

- Familiar working in cloud environments (AWS and Azure)

- Familiarly/working experience with Purview

-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, a go-getter attitude and ability to effectively communicate with upper-level management and executives.

- Bachelor’s degree in Cybersecurity, Information Security, Computer Science, or a related field. Relevant certifications (e.g., Security+, CISM, CISA, etc.) are a plus.

- Comfortable working with upper-level management and internal stakeholders to communicate escalations


Nice to Have Skills & Experience

- CrowdStrike experience

- Splunk experience

- Microsoft environments
